Spring has sprung and a weekend too busy to be bothered with mucking about with computers, so my belated congrats to the Davitt Award winners announced on Saturday night (Thanks Angela Savage for the twitter feed).

Adult Fiction Winner

Sulari Gentill, A Decline in Prophets  (Pantera Press) 

Highly Commended Carolyn Morwood, Death and the Spanish Lady  (Pulp Fiction Press) 

Children's / Young Adult

Meg McKinlay, Surface Tension  (Walker Books)

True Crime

Liz Porter, Cold Case Files: Past crimes solved by new forensic science    (PanMacmillan) 

Best Debut Novel

Jaye Ford, Beyond Fear (Random House Australia)

Reader's Choice

Joint Winners:

Jaye Ford, Beyond Fear (Random House Australia)

and

Y.A. Erskine, The Brotherhood (Bantam)
